2001 Yukon SLT 215,000K.
Pulled trans, had it rebuilt at 160k,
alternator,
rear auto level shocks,
water pump,
front windshield washer pump,
fuel sender/pump,
abs block,
plugs/wires,
wheel hub,
intake gasket,
Rear Main and oilpan at 99,999 (under Warranty) Not 1 drip or leak today!
radio.
Many batteries(AZ heat kills within 3 yrs)
All relatively inexpensive and easy to do yourself. Bought it with 40k on the clock. Best vehicle I've owned.
